PHYTOCHEMICAL SCREENING, ANTIOXIDANT AND ANTIBACTERIAL ACTIVITIES OF EXTRACTS AND FRACTIONS OF Dillenia suffruticosa LEAVES

Abstract: Dillenia suffruticosa or ‘Simpur bini’ is known to have ethnomedicinal properties and had been used traditionally to heal wounds, relieve fever and rheumatism. There has been limited studies carried out on this species, therefore, this study aims to evaluate the phytochemical contents, antioxidant and antibacterial activities of aqueous extract, methanol extract and its fractions obtained from the leaves of D. suffruticosa. “…Methanol extract of stem bark of D. serrata scavenged DPPH radicals (48.2-59.7%) at 100 μg/mL (Sabandar et al 2020). Methanol extract D. suffruticosa leaves has IC50 305.09±4.53 μg/mL DPPH radical scavenging (Yakop et al 2020;Sinala et al 2020). This study used ascorbic acid as a comparison (Table 5).…”

“…Based on the results obtained, the extract's yield is large. Bordoloi et al 2019 reported that ethanolic extract of D. indica has a 4.7% yield, 10.07% of methanol extract of fruit (Gogoi et al 2012), and 21.8% in methanolic extract of D. suffruticosa leaves (Yakop et al 2020).…”
